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Wanderings in Arabia, Vol. 1 of 2 No critical estimate could sum up better than the above the characteristics of Arabia Deserta. And it is for the sake of the appeal that this great book should make to a wider audience than the few who feel enthusiasm for Arab things that I have sought and obtained the author's sanction to make the abridgment of his narrative here presented. It is, indeed, in the conviction that the book has only to become known to the English public to be hailed by all for what it is - a masterpiece second to none in our literature of travel - that I have attempted the task of abridgment. And here the writer must confess that he knows no other book of travel which makes him so proud that the author is an Englishman. Gentleness, courage, humanity, endurance, and the insight of genius, these were the qualities that carried Doughty safely through his strange achievement of adventuring alone, a professed Chris tian, amid the fanatical Arabians. That he proclaimed his race and faith wherever he went is a supreme testimony to the firm ness of his spirit and to the magnetism of a frank and mild nature that evoked so often in response the humanity underlying the Arabs' fanaticism. His narrative, indeed, testifies how much milk of human kindness the solitary stranger could count upon finding in the breast of all but the most fanatical Mohammedans. But it is surely less the author's valuable discoveries than the intense human interest of his book that will bring him enduring fame What an unforgettable picture it is, that of this Englishman of an old-fashioned stamp adventuring alone for many long months in the deserts of Arabia, going each day not very sure of his life, yet obstinately proclaiming to all men, to sheykhs and shepherds, to fanatical tribesmen in every encampment, that he is a N asrany, a Christian With a pistol hidden in his bosom, and a few gold pieces in his purse, with a sack of clothes and books and drugs thrown on the hired camel of his rafiks, or wandering guides.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Heart of Arabia, Vol. 1 of 2: A Record of Travel Exploration Of the pleasant year I spent sojourning and wandering amid the deserts and oases of Arabia I have endeavoured to compile a record, at once fully descriptive of my own experiences and designed to serve my successors as a faithful guide in their wanderings, when in their turn they take up the torch which has been held in the past by so many distinguished hands - Niebuhr and Burckhardt, Sadlier and Burton, Doughty and the Blunts, Wallin and Wellsted, Huber and Halevy, Euting and Guarmani, and, in modern times, Shakespear and Gertrude Bell, to name but a few of those whose names are writ large on the scroll of Arabian explorers. It was with little fitness to undertake geographical or scientific work of any kind that I entered Arabia, but chance led me far afield from the tracks of those who had been in that country before me; and natural curiosity, fortified by a sense of duty, impelled me to record day by day and almost hour by hour everything I saw or heard in the course of my wanderings in the hope that some day, the grain being separated from the chaff, there might remain a residue of useful matter worthy of presentation to the world. The few scientific instruments I carried with me, with a limited knowledge of their proper uses, have enabled the experts of the Royal Geographical Society to use the detailed itineraries of my journeys in the preparation of reasonable maps of a country hitherto in great part conventionally charted on the basis of second-hand information.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Travels of Ali Bey, Vol. 1 of 2: In Morocco, Tripoli, Cyprus, Egypt, Arabia, Syria, and Turkey; Between the Years 1803 and 1807 I handed it to the captain, who ordered that no one should come on shore, and went away to show my pass port to the kaid, or governor. He sent it to the Spanish consul for examination. The consul, having found it to be genuine, sent it back to me by the vice-consul, who came to our ship, with a Turk, called sid-moham med, chief of the gunners of the place, and who was sent by the governor to interrogate me again. They asked me the same questions as the captain of the port had; and, having returned me my passport, they went away to make their report to the kaid. Soon after, the captain of the port returned with an order from the kaid for my landing. I went on shore immediately, and was conducted to the kaid, leaning on two Moors, because I had received a wound in my leg, when my travelling carriage was overturned in Spain. He received me very well, and put to me again al most the same questions which I had answered already. He then ordered a house to be prepared for me, and dis. Missed me with many compliments and offers of ser vice. I made my acknowledgment to the kaid for his civilities, and left him, supported by my two assistants, who took me to a barber's shop.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Oriental Zigzag, or Wanderings in Syria, Moab, Abyssinia, and Egypt Some of the streets are filthy in the extreme, and our only marvel was how the inhabitants contrived to escape the cholera. Very remarkable is the Greek quarter of the town, with its dreadful hovels sheltering its fearfully degraded population. Here one is oppressed with a peculiar faint odour, which we found no difficulty in trac ing to the environment of vast establishments of wire. Hided Maltese pigs which are maintained in spite of the Mussulman abhorrence of the unclean animal. Against the Greek element, indeed, remonstrance would be of no avail in Alexandria. The Greek is the only nation that the Egyptian dreads. Upon the most trifling provoca tion or insult from a Mahommedan, the Greek does not hesitate to fillet him at once; and the consequence is that the Arab, fully alive to his antagonist's resolute ways, carefully avoids getting into disputes with him. Notwithstanding this radical opposition of race, however, it is curious to remark that the Greeks largely employ themselves as money-lenders to the Arabs, and act as small bankers to them. With the exception of the French, they are the only people who ever get their loans repaid; and, in explanation of the success of the French in that section of commercial life, it is only necessary here to observe that the French Consulate are wont to make most extraordinary demands when pay ments of money are not faithfully observed.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Travels in the East, Including a Journey in the Holy Land, Vol. 1 The notes which I have here consented to give to the public have none of these merits. I yield them with regret; they are merely in the shape of recollections for myself, and were destined for that purpose alone. There is nothing of science, history, geography, or manners in them - the public was far from my thoughts when I wrote them - and how did I write them? Sometimes at noon, during the mid-day repose, under the shade of a palm-tree, or under the ruins of a monument in the desert more often in the evening beneath a tent, beaten by the wind and rain, by the light of a torch of resin; one day in the cell of a Maro nite convent on Lebanon another day amid the rolling of an Arab boat, or upon the deck of a brig, in the midst of the shouts of sailors, neighing of horses, interruptions and distractions of all sorts by land and sea; sometimes eight days without writing at all; at other times losing the scattered pages of an album, torn by jackals, or steeped in the brine of the sea.
